A Real Wedding, II A bit more from Melinda...Once I had my dress and the colors picked out, the rest waseasy! I used a color palette of black and linen for the rest of the décor. Thefinal inspiration for the rest of the wedding came from a piece of fabriccalled Waverly Damask (see picture). As I was on a budget, and I did not wantto interfere with the natural environment of the location too much, I decidedto buy a bolt of the fabric off eBay and have them made into tablecloths forthe reception. The venue and the winerywere so naturally beautiful, and full of hidden details, that putting pink orbright colors into the space would have been jarring, but the black and whitedamask pattern still made an important impact. I used lanterns that we found ata discount store for our centerpieces, and black chargers from Michael’s to addan extra splash of black under the white dinner plates.I did much of the same type of planning for the ceremonydecoration – the view from the outdoor deck was stunning – mountain vistas androlling plains – so I did not want a lot of interference with it. I chose tobuy two blue and purple hydrangea plants (not flowers, but actual plants) andplopped them into the urns at the end of the aisle. The bridesmaids all carriedblue and purple hydrangea blooms, and I carried the same hydrangeas withpearled white flowers. The groomsmen all wore hydrangea flowers with greenery.Again, hydrangeas in September were inexpensive, and we just went to Home Depotfor the hydrangea plants. Cheap!More to come!
